Output 59e6677233a126739f7513e87a7a1c1b46fc4ac3904fa5d1c7fb739963a03ec5:0

value
2296720
script pubkey
OP_0 OP_PUSHBYTES_20 dfad6a904d745960ac07d4598fea40d9a97173a3
address
bc1qm7kk4yzdw3vkptq863vcl6jqmx5hzuar8vma48
transaction
59e6677233a126739f7513e87a7a1c1b46fc4ac3904fa5d1c7fb739963a03ec5
spent
true